docker 这正常吗?
Is this normal for docker?
我正在构建一个安装 ant、maven、phantomjs、g运行t-cli 的映像,但是当我 运行
docker build
开始将构建上下文发送到 docker 需要一段时间,然后大小为
Sending build context to Docker daemon 7.451 GB
这是正常现象还是我可以做些什么来加快速度?
docker build
压缩并传输您 运行 所在的目录,包括所有子目录。如果你想在构建上下文中包含更少的数据(从而加快速度),你应该 运行 docker build
来自包含构建的最少数据的目录。
因此 docker build
至少需要一个 Dockerfile
并且通常您希望将源代码包含在本地目录中(尽管 Docker 可以从其他来源提取它)。
我正在构建一个安装 ant、maven、phantomjs、g运行t-cli 的映像,但是当我 运行
docker build
开始将构建上下文发送到 docker 需要一段时间,然后大小为
Sending build context to Docker daemon 7.451 GB
这是正常现象还是我可以做些什么来加快速度?
docker build
压缩并传输您 运行 所在的目录,包括所有子目录。如果你想在构建上下文中包含更少的数据(从而加快速度),你应该 运行 docker build
来自包含构建的最少数据的目录。
因此 docker build
至少需要一个 Dockerfile
并且通常您希望将源代码包含在本地目录中(尽管 Docker 可以从其他来源提取它)。